Kenneth Olsson, who has previously worked at ATP Ejendomme, has been hired as a new investment director for the real estate arm of ATP, Denmark’s biggest pension fund.
He will serve as its first CIO, a newly created role with ATP Real Estate, which covers both Danish and foreign investments and asset management.
Olsson currently works as real estate investment manager for Danish labor-market pension fund Industriens Pension. He worked at ATP Real Estate as portfolio and deputy director from 2003 to 2018.
